University of Southern Maine Glickman Family Library
Library
Photo: Faolin42, CC BY-SA 4.0.
The Albert Brenner Glickman Family Library is an academic library operated by the University of Southern Maine on its campus in Portland, Maine. The building, which stands 7 stories tall, was dedicated by Governor Angus King in October 1997. Hadlock Field
Stadium
Photo: Dudesleeper, CC BY 2.5.
Delta Dental Park at Hadlock Field is a minor league baseball stadium in Portland, Maine. The stadium is home to the Portland Sea Dogs of the Eastern League and the Portland High School Bulldogs baseball team. Hadlock Field is situated 3,100 feet southwest of WBAE-AM (Portland).
Fitzpatrick Stadium
Stadium
Photo: Thomas.macmillan, Public domain.
James J. Fitzpatrick Stadium is a 6,000-seat multi-purpose outdoor stadium in Portland, Maine, United States. Built in 1930, it sits between Interstate 295, Hadlock Field baseball stadium, King Middle School, and the Portland Exposition Building. Arts District
Neighborhood
The Arts District is a section of downtown Portland, Maine’s designated in 1995 as to promote the cultural community and creative economy of the city. It covers a large part of upper Congress Street towards the West End and spans Congress Street toward the East ending at Portland City Hall and its Merrill Auditorium concert hall.
West End
Quarter
The West End is a downtown neighborhood in Portland, Maine. It is located on the western side of Portland's peninsula primarily on Bramhall Hill and is noted for its architecture and history.
